“…These have been shown in some cases to be more toxic than the active ingredient. For instance, the glyphosate formulations Roundup and Vision are 10-100 times more toxic to fish than the active ingredient alone (Folmar et al 1979;Servizi et al 1987;Morgan et al 1991). Rainbow trout are approximately 50 times more sensitive to Roundup (96-h LC50 ¼ 12 mg/L) than to Rodeo (96-h LC50 ¼ 580 mg/L; Mitchell et al 1987).…”

“…There are very few studies investigating the effect of Release or TBEE on avoidance response of fish and larval amphibians. Changes in rainbow trout behavior occurred at 0.6 mg/L TBEE [37]. Larval amphibian avoidance response was affected at TBEE concentrations of 1.2 mg/L [11].…”

“…Concentrations of triclopyr in aquatic environments have been recorded at 0.25 to 7.86 mg/L, with a maximum expected environmental concentration of 2.7 mg/L [46][47][48][49][50][51]. Experiments examining median lethal concentration values on fish suggest that lethal concentrations may be >200 mg/L [45,52].
